37.032 Coleophora
albitarsella Zeller, 1849

Food Plant: Calamintha spp. (Calamint), Clinopodium vulgare (wild Basil), Glechoma hederacea (Ground-ivy), Mentha spp. (Mints), Salvia horminoides (Wild Clary), Prunella vulgaris (Self-heal), Origanum vulgare (Marjoram), Thymus spp. (Thyme) Mine: September - May Notes: Makes visible white blotches on the leaves as it feeds. Found in a wide range of habitats.The mine shown is on Mentha pulegium (Pennyroyal). Data: 07.ix.2014, Whisby Nature Reserve, South Lincs., VC53 Image:© Martin Gray
